Description
Merthyr Valleys Homes are looking for a suitably qualified and experience Contractor to undertake the provision of Lifting Equipment Servicing and Maintenance. The assets included include but are not limited to: - Stairlifts, - Platform lifts - Through floor lifts - Hoists
Total Quantity or Scope
Merthyr Valleys Homes (MVH) is responsible for provision of adaptations to all of its disabled tenants, which includes installation, maintenance and repair of a number of different types of items of personal lifting equipment (‘Lift Assets’) such as hoists, stairlifts, platform lifts and through floor lifts Merthyr Valleys Homes is seeking a suitably skilled, experienced and accredited Contractor to provide servicing, maintenance, repairs as well as removal, storage and reinstallation of Lift Assets.
